Barcelona President Joan Laporta Dismisses Real Madrid Comeback Aspirations Against Arsenal

Barcelona President Joan Laporta has characterized Real Madrid’s optimism regarding a potential comeback against Arsenal as “nonsense.” He emphasized his commitment to focusing on FC Barcelona’s progress in the UEFA Champions League.

Barcelona has secured a place in the semi-finals, whereas Real Madrid faces a challenging situation, having lost the first leg of their tie with Arsenal by a score of 3-0. While the historical capability for comebacks is often attributed to Los Blancos, Laporta remains resolute in his focus on Barcelona’s accomplishments. When approached for his thoughts on Real Madrid’s ambitions during an interview with Diario AS, he chuckled and remarked, “Let’s put an end to that nonsense and allow me to relish our advancement to the semi-finals. This is a recurring theme.”

He continued, “I am an avid football fan, and today, I take particular pleasure in knowing that we are already in the semi-finals, which is our primary concern. We still have goals to achieve this season, and we believe that anything is possible.”

Laporta concluded by praising his team’s performance, expressing satisfaction with the players’ dedication and talent, as well as Hansi Flick’s adept management, stating, “It’s truly a delight to watch Barcelona in action.”
